Hot vulcanized rubber coated rollers are designed to perform similar functions to disc rollers, but with a significant advantage in wear resistance and durability. The presence of a vulcanized rubber coating applied directly to the steel tube makes them particularly suitable for harsh working environments, where the conveyor belt is subject to abrasive conditions or frequent contact with aggressive materials. This additional protection allows the life of the roller to be prolonged by improving the mechanical seal and the ability to absorb shocks and vibrations.
Further distinguishing this type of roller is its enlarged diameter, which promotes more even load distribution and reduces the risk of premature deformation. The steel tube, the load-bearing element of the structure, provides high resistance to mechanical stress, keeping the configuration stable even under intensive use. Due to their versatility, vulcanized rubber coated rollers can be used in a variety of industrial applications, performing the same functions as disc rollers but offering superior protection and greater reliability over time.
The integration of durable materials and designs not only maximizes roller life, but also preserves the integrity of the conveyor belt, helping to reduce maintenance and improve overall operational efficiency.
